The reason is that "brctl setfd ..." works fine in an unprivileged
container, but libvirt-daemon fails. In other words: brctl shows that
it *is* possible to create and manage bridges in an unprivileged
container, but libvirt-daemon isn't doing it correctly.

Upstream bug is at https://bugs.dpdk.org/show_bug.cgi?id=97#c18
(Can't link it here :-/ )
They say:
- No crash seen with code generated by clang-6 or gcc-6, probably because they
do not generate AVX512 instructions.
- Crash is confirmed with gcc-7 and gcc-8 when using AVX2 version of rte_memcpy.
